Name: Ureaplasma cati Harasawa et al. 1990
Etymology: ca’ti. L. masc. adj. catus, a cat (or cattus); L. gen. masc. n. cati, of a cat
Pronunciation, gender: KA-ti, neuter
Type strain: ATCC 49228; CIP 106088; F2; NCTC 11710

Valid publication:
Harasawa R, Imada Y, Ito M, Koshimizu K, Cassell GH, Barile MF. Ureaplasma felinum sp. nov. and Ureaplasma cati sp. nov. isolated from the oral cavities of cats. Int J Syst Bacteriol 1990; 40:45-51.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: correct name (and explicitly recommended for medical use)
Parent taxon: Ureaplasma Shepard et al. 1974 (Approved Lists 1980)
